git分支合并简书

不及物动词 其他 67

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Git分支合并是指将一个分支的修改内容合并到另一个分支上,以保持代码的同步和一致性。下面是关于git分支合并的简单步骤:

    1. 首先,使用`git branch`命令查看当前的分支列表,确保你在正确的分支上。

    2. 使用`git checkout`命令切换到接受合并的分支。例如,如果你想将feature分支的修改内容合并到master分支上,那么应该执行`git checkout master`命令。

    3. 使用`git merge`命令进行分支合并。例如,执行`git merge feature`命令将feature分支的修改内容合并到当前分支(这里是master分支)上。

    4. 在分支合并过程中,可能会发生冲突。冲突是指两个分支上对同一文件或同一行代码进行了不同的修改,导致无法自动合并。当出现冲突时,需要手动解决冲突并提交修改。

    5. 解决冲突后,使用`git add`命令将解决冲突的文件添加到暂存区。

    6. 最后,使用`git commit`命令提交合并的修改。

    在实际应用中,需要根据项目的实际情况来确定分支的合并策略。常见的策略有:

    – Fast-forward合并:如果当前分支的修改内容是基于要合并的分支的最新提交,那么可以直接进行Fast-forward合并。这种合并不会产生新的提交节点。

    – 3-way合并:如果当前分支和要合并的分支有共同的提交节点,那么使用3-way合并。这种合并会将两个分支的共同提交节点作为合并的基础,然后将两个分支上的修改内容进行合并。

    总之,Git分支合并是保持代码同步和一致性的重要操作。熟练掌握分支合并的步骤和策略,可以提高团队协作的效率。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Git中,分支合并是将一个分支中的更改集成到另一个分支中的过程。这在团队协作和版本控制中非常常见。下面是关于如何在Git中进行分支合并的一些要点。

    1. 创建分支:首先,创建一个新的分支,可以使用以下命令:
    “`
    git branch
    “`

    2. 切换分支:使用以下命令切换到要合并更改的目标分支:
    “`
    git checkout
    “`

    3. 合并分支:使用以下命令将源分支的更改合并到目标分支:
    “`
    git merge“`

    4. 解决冲突:在合并分支时,如果两个分支上存在相同文件的不同更改,就会产生冲突。此时,需要手动解决冲突,并使用以下命令标记解决后的文件:
    “`
    git add
    “`

    5. 提交合并:在解决完所有冲突后,使用以下命令提交合并结果:
    “`
    git commit -m “Mergeinto
    “`

    需要注意的是,分支合并是一个重要的操作,需要谨慎处理。在合并分支之前,最好先确认所有更改是否都已经提交,并确保目标分支是最新的。此外,最好在合并前与团队成员进行协商和沟通,以避免对他人的工作造成不必要的干扰。

    总而言之,分支合并是Git中非常常见的操作,通过合并不同的分支,可以将不同开发线上的更改集成到一起,从而实现团队协作和版本控制的目的。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Git中,分支合并是一个非常重要的操作。分支合并允许开发者将不同的代码分支合并到一起,使得不同的开发工作能够同步。在本文中,我将为你详细介绍如何在Git中进行分支合并。

    1. 查看分支

    在进行分支合并之前,首先需要查看当前的分支情况。可以使用以下命令查看当前分支:

    “`
    git branch
    “`

    该命令会列出所有的本地分支,并用一个星号表示当前所在的分支。

    2. 创建分支

    如果需要合并的分支还未创建,可以使用以下命令创建一个新的分支:

    “`
    git branch [branch_name]
    “`

    执行该命令后,将创建一个名为[branch_name]的新分支。

    3. 切换分支

    使用以下命令可以切换到其他分支:

    “`
    git checkout [branch_name]
    “`

    执行该命令后,你将切换到名为[branch_name]的分支。

    4. 合并分支

    当你想要将一个分支的代码合并到当前分支时,可以使用以下命令:

    “`
    git merge [branch_name]
    “`

    该命令将会将[branch_name]分支的代码合并到当前分支。

    5. 解决冲突

    有时候,在分支合并过程中可能会出现冲突。这是因为Git无法自动决定如何合并两个不同的修改,需要手动解决冲突。当出现冲突时,Git会在冲突的文件中标记出冲突的地方。开发者需要手动修改这些冲突,并将文件保存。

    解决完冲突后,可以使用以下命令将修改后的文件添加到暂存区:

    “`
    git add [file_name]
    “`

    6. 提交合并

    在解决完所有的冲突后,可以使用以下命令提交合并的结果:

    “`
    git commit -m “Merge branch [branch_name]”
    “`

    这将会提交一个合并的commit,并填写合并的分支信息。

    7. 删除分支

    在合并完成后,如果不再需要某个分支,可以使用以下命令删除分支:

    “`
    git branch -d [branch_name]
    “`

    执行该命令后,将会删除名为[branch_name]的分支。

    8. 推送到远程仓库

    当你想要将合并的结果推送到远程仓库时,可以使用以下命令:

    “`
    git push origin [branch_name]
    “`

    该命令会将名为[branch_name]的分支推送到远程仓库。

    总结:

    在Git中,分支合并是一项非常基础而重要的操作。通过正确地使用分支合并,可以将不同的开发工作进行同步,保证项目的进度和代码的可维护性。通过本文的介绍,你已经了解了如何在Git中进行分支合并的方法和操作流程。希望这对你有所帮助!

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部